Water Coming From Air Conditioning Unit. When your unit attempts to cool your home down when temperatures outside are under 60 degrees the coils could freeze up causing the unit to leak water. Lets start with the basics. However rest assured that all air conditioners are guilty of producing water. How much water leaks from your air conditioner however depends on a couple of factors including the thermostat setting and the temperature outside.
